Why Summer is the Ideal Season for Dental Implants: Transform Your Smile!

Family enjoying summer beach vacation near a cruise ship.

Summer Smiles: Why Now Is the Best Time for Dental Implants

Summer is often associated with vacations, outdoor fun, and relaxation, but it’s also the ideal season for a dental transformation. If you’ve been contemplating dental implants to replace failing or missing teeth, consider scheduling your procedure during the summer months. The combination of free time, fewer commitments, and a welcoming environment makes summer an unmatched opportunity for enhancing your smile.

The Convenience of Summer Procedures

For many, summer is a slower-paced period, particularly for those working in traditional jobs or attending school. Without the regular hustle and bustle of daily life, taking a few days off for dental work becomes much easier. Families experience a break as children are not in school, making summer a perfect backdrop for focusing on personal health and well-being.

Whether you’re a working parent, a college student, or just someone looking to enhance their smile, summer provides the needed time to recover without the usual stresses of work and school schedules.

Enjoying Recovery with Fun Activities

Post-procedure, many people worry about recovery, but it can be surprisingly easy and enjoyable. Sunbathing, beach walks, or simply relaxing in your backyard can elevate your healing experience. You will need to follow some dietary restrictions immediately after your dental implant surgery, but the activities you can participate in are ample, allowing you to enjoy the beautiful summer without significant disruptions.

Imagine finishing your dental work and that same evening, heading out to watch a concert or picnic with friends, showcasing your new smile.

A One-Day Transformation

One of the standout features of dental implants provided by specialized clinics like New Teeth Now is the ability to complete the procedure within a single day. This means you can leave the clinic with a beautiful set of new teeth without waiting weeks or months. For busy adults and students, the convenience of achieving immediate results is a significant factor, allowing you to return to your summer fun with confidence.

Discover How New Teeth Now's In-House Lab Transforms Smiles

Update A Transformation Beyond Just TeethFor many individuals, the search for full-mouth dental implants is not merely about replacing missing teeth; it's also about restoring self-esteem and enhancing one's quality of life. At New Teeth Now, patients find that their journey is not only aided by surgical precision but also by a unique innovation in implant dentistry: a fully integrated in-house dental laboratory.Why an In-House Lab Makes a DifferenceWhen it comes to ongoing dental care, many practices opt for outsourcing lab work. However, this often results in delays and miscommunication, ultimately affecting the final product. At New Teeth Now, the presence of an in-house lab ensures seamless collaboration among restorative doctors and lab technicians, enhancing the quality of care.Artistry Meets TechnologyThe lab team at New Teeth Now comprises highly trained technicians who marry cutting-edge digital technology with skilled craftsmanship. Every iteration of a patient’s smile is an artistic endeavor, requiring patience and expertise. According to Dr. Elliot Dibbs, a restorative expert at New Teeth Now, each tooth is sculpted to match not just the patient's smile but their unique personality. This patient-centric approach guarantees that every smile looks natural and feels comfortable.Real-Time Collaboration for Optimal OutcomesAn essential advantage of having an in-house lab is the potential for real-time communication. This collaboration leads to faster turnaround times and more precise results. The technicians, working closely with the restorative team, make immediate adjustments based on patient feedback, ensuring that each restoration fits perfectly and fulfills the patient’s vision.Enhancing Patient ExperienceWhat sets New Teeth Now apart is their comprehensive approach to dental care. Patients benefit from a streamlined process that emphasizes personal engagement. Dr. Dibbs states that the collaborative nature of their lab allows for a more meaningful experience—like constructing a home where the foundation (the implants) is carefully laid and the home (the smile) is crafted by a dedicated team.Quality Control and CustomizationOne of the primary advantages of in-house dental labs is quality control. This ensures that every restoration meets the high standards that patients expect. The proximity of the lab to the dental team allows for rigorous oversight at every stage of production. In addition, the customization offered can lead to uniquely tailored results, enabling patients to have input in the design process—the size, shape, and color of their new teeth.The Future of Dental CareAs the dental field progresses, the emphasis on patient-centered care continues to grow.
